Safeguarding Children Training - Fitzroy
Aug 25
Description

The Safeguarding Children Training focuses on building knowledge about child abuse and neglect and it explains practical steps that staff and volunteers can take to create conditions that make children and young people safer in an organizational context.

Safeguarding Children Training topics:

1.      Defining child abuse and neglect
2.      Child sexual abuse
3.      Creating safer environments
4.      Recruitment and screening
5.      Dealing with reports and allegations of abuse

The training is interactive and seeks to engage the learner through discussion and participation in a range of learning activities e.g. case studies, role plays, myth/fact exercises. Materials will be provided to all course participants.

Learning outcomes:
  • Raises awareness of all forms of child abuse within an organisation.
  • Encourages a “whole of organization” approach to protecting children and young people.
  • Builds knowledge on how sex offenders operate and target children and young people within organizations.
  • Articulates key strategies for building a child-safe organization.
  • Provides clear guidance with respect to responding to child abuse.
